Visit to Saudi Arabia: Joe Biden warns against acts of violence against government critics

The US President has met the Saudi Arabian Crown Prince. He blamed Mohammed bin Salman for the murder of journalist Jamal Khashoggi. US President Joe Biden said he warned Saudi Crown Prince Mohammed bin Salman of future acts of violence against government critics at their meeting in Jeddah. He made it clear to the heir to the throne that another act like the murder of journalist and government critic Jamal Khashoggi in October 2018 would result in a "response" from the United States, said Biden after his consultations with bin Salman in the Saudi Arabian port city. Khashoggi 's murder was "at the top" of the topics of conversation, the US President said. Khashoggi disappeared from the Saudi consulate in Istanbul in 2018. Later it turned out that he was murdered by a special commando. He had published opinion pieces from the United States that criticized the crown prince.
